หน้าแรก
หน้าแรก
สมมติว่าต่อไปนี้เป็นวัตถุของเรา − const details = { name: 'John', age: {}, marks: { marks: {} } } เราจำเป็นต้องลบวัตถุสีดำด้านบน คุณสามารถใช้ forEach() พร้อมกับ typeof และ delete เพื่อลบวัตถุที่ว่างเปล่า ตัวอย่าง ต่อไปนี้เป็นรหัส - const details = {
หากมีการใช้ const ในโปรแกรม และหากคุณพยายามกำหนดค่าให้กับตัวแปร const ใหม่ จะเกิดข้อผิดพลาดขึ้น สมมติว่าต่อไปนี้คือตัวแปร const ของเรา - const result = (first, second) => first * second; ตอนนี้ เราจะพยายามกำหนดค่าให้กับตัวแปร const ใหม่และพบข้อผิดพลาดในผลลัพธ์ ตัวอย่าง ต่อไปนี้เป็นรหัส - const
อันดับแรก รับวันที่ปัจจุบัน - var currentDateTime = new Date(); หากต้องการรับวันที่/เวลาปัจจุบันเป็นวินาที ให้ใช้ getTime()/1000 ตัวอย่าง ต่อไปนี้เป็นรหัส - var currentDateTime = new Date(); console.log("The current date time is as follows:"); console.log(currentDateTime); var resultInSe
โดยพื้นฐานแล้วจะบอกเกี่ยวกับจริงหรือเท็จ หากพบรายการแล้วจะคืนค่าเป็น true มิฉะนั้นจะส่งคืน false คุณสามารถทำสิ่งเดียวกันนี้ได้ในอาร์เรย์ JavaScript โดยใช้การรวม ตัวอย่าง ต่อไปนี้เป็นรหัส - var nameList = [ "John", "David", &
สำหรับสิ่งนี้ ให้ใช้ Math.random() เพื่อสร้างรหัสผ่านแบบสุ่ม ตัวอย่าง ต่อไปนี้เป็นรหัส - function makePassword(maxLengthPass) { var collectionOfLetters = "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z0123456789"; var generatedPassword = "";  
สมมติว่าต่อไปนี้คือปุ่มของเรา − <button id="buttonDemo" style="background:skyblue;margin-left:10px;">Press Me</button> ในการกรอกช่องป้อนข้อมูลด้านล่าง สีของปุ่มด้านบนควรเปลี่ยน - <input type="text" id="changeColorDemo" style="margin-left:1
สำหรับสิ่งนี้ ให้ใช้ document.querySelectorAll() ตัวอย่าง ต่อไปนี้เป็นรหัส - <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0&qu
ใช่ คุณสามารถใช้แนวคิดของคลาสได้ หากคุณต้องการตรวจสอบประเภทข้อมูลจริง คุณสามารถใช้ Instanceof ได้ อินสแตนซ์ของบอกเกี่ยวกับประเภทข้อมูล นี่คือตัวอย่างโค้ด JavaScript ซึ่งจะให้คำอธิบายสั้น ๆ เกี่ยวกับวิธีการสร้างชนิดข้อมูลใหม่และวิธีการตรวจสอบชนิดข้อมูล ที่นี่ ฉันจะให้การใช้งานแบบกำหนดเองเพื่อตรวจสอบ
ตัวอย่าง ต่อไปนี้เป็นรหัสเพื่อจัดรูปแบบค่าวันที่ใน JavaScript - function changeDateFormat(dateValues, addToFront = "") { return typeof dateValues == "object" ? addToFront + dateValues.toLocaleDateString() : ""; } var currentDate = new Date(); console.log(&
ตามที่เราทราบดีว่า ESC มีรหัส 27 หากคุณจะใช้รหัส 27 คุณสามารถจัดการกับเงื่อนไขได้ ตัวอย่าง ต่อไปนี้เป็นรหัส - <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=d
สมมติว่าต่อไปนี้คืออาร์เรย์ของเราที่มีค่าสตริงและยังไม่ได้กำหนด - var studentNames = ["Mike", undefined, "Adam", "Bob", undefined, "Carol"]; ใช้ sort() เพื่อจัดเรียงอาร์เรย์ด้านบน ตัวอย่าง ต่อไปนี้เป็นรหัส - var studentNames = ["Mike", undefined, &
คุณสามารถใช้ตัวฟังเหตุการณ์สำหรับการคลิกได้ ตัวอย่าง ต่อไปนี้เป็นรหัส - <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"&g
เราสามารถแยกชั่วโมงและนาทีจากวันที่ปัจจุบัน หากค่าชั่วโมงมากกว่า 12 จะเป็น PM มิฉะนั้น AM ตัวอย่าง ต่อไปนี้เป็นรหัส - function dateTOAMORPM(currentDateTime) { var hrs = currentDateTime.getHours(); var mnts = currentDateTime.getMinutes(); var AMPM = hrs >= 1
สมมติว่าต่อไปนี้คือวัตถุอาร์เรย์ของเรา − var arrayObject = [ "John", "David", "Mike" ] คุณสามารถใช้คุณสมบัติ length เพื่อตั้งค่าความยาวเป็น 0 และล้างหน่วยความจำ ไวยากรณ์ดังต่อไปนี
ในการแทนที่รายการแบบสุ่ม ให้ใช้ random() พร้อมกับ map() ตัวอย่าง ต่อไปนี้เป็นรหัส - function substituteRandomValue(names, size) { return function () { const index = new Set(); do { index.add(Math.floor(Math.ran
สมมติว่าเรามีสตริงต่อไปนี้ − var sentence= "My Name is John Smith. I live in UK. My Favourite Subject is JavaScript." เราจำเป็นต้องแทนที่คำต่อไปนี้ในประโยคข้างต้นด้วยค่าเฉพาะ “ไม่พร้อมใช้งาน” - var values = ['John','Smith','UK','JavaScript'] ดังนั้น ผลลัพ
สมมติว่าต่อไปนี้คืออาร์เรย์ที่ไม่เรียงลำดับของเราที่มีจำนวนลบและบวก - var arr = [10, -22, 54, 3, 4, 45, 6]; ตัวอย่าง ต่อไปนี้เป็นรหัสที่จะใช้ Bubble Sort - function bubbleSort(numberArray, size) { for (var lastIndex = size - 1; lastIndex > 0; lastIndex--) { for
สมมติว่าต่อไปนี้คืออาร์เรย์ของเรา – var values = ['studentNames', 'studentMarks']; คุณสามารถใช้ map() เพื่อแปลงอาร์เรย์ด้านบนเป็นอาร์เรย์ใหม่ (คีย์ในวัตถุ) - var convertIntoNewArray = values.map(arrayObject => ({ [arrayObject]: [] })); ตัวอย่าง ต่อไปนี้เป็นรหัส - var values = [
สมมติว่าเรามีแท็กวิดีโอตัวอย่างต่อไปนี้ในหน้าเว็บ <video class="hideVideo" width="350" height="255" controls> <source src="" id="unique_video_id"> You cannot play video here...... </video> หากต้องการซ่อนวิ
สมมติว่าต่อไปนี้คืออาร์เรย์ของเรา – var details = [ { studentName: "John", studentAge: 23 }, { studentName: "David", studentAge: 24 }, &n